IBM FlashSystem

The following requirements and limitations apply to VMware and Veeam Agent integrations:

  • [For IBM Spectrum Virtualize 8.4.2 and later with iSCSI connectivity] During Backup from Storage Snapshots and storage rescan, storage snapshot export to a proxy is required. If the default proxy is used, Veeam Backup & Replication creates a service host with the "VeeamAUX" prefix in the default portset of the storage system. If you want to send traffic using a custom portset, you can manually specify the required portset in the service host settings. If another proxy is used, check that the host that performs the proxy role has the required portset in the host settings.
  • [For IBM Spectrum Virtualize 8.5.0 and earlier] Before you add the storage system to the backup infrastructure, make sure that a license for the IBM Spectrum Virtualize storage system supports IBM FlashCopy.
  • [For Veeam Backup & Replication version 12.1 (build 12.1.0.2131) and later] For IBM Spectrum Virtualize 8.5.1 and later, Veeam Backup & Replication uses storage volume snapshot technology automatically that does not require license support for IBM FlashCopy. Within the FlashSystem 5000 family, only FlashSystem 5045 model supports the new storage volume snapshot technology.

Once a storage volume snapshot is created (with or without Veeam Backup & Replication), FlashCopies are stopped being created. However, you can still restore from previously created FlashCopies. You can continue working with FlashCopy by setting a registry value. For more information, contact Veeam Customer Support. Note that before you set a registry value, you need to remove all storage volume snapshots.

  • [For Veeam Backup & Replication versions prior to 12.1 (build 12.1.0.2131)] For IBM Spectrum Virtualize 8.5.1 and later, make sure that volumes with FlashCopies do not contain storage volume snapshots. Otherwise, creation of FlashCopies fails.
  • [For Veeam Backup & Replication version 12.1 (build 12.1.0.2131) and later] For IBM Spectrum Virtualize 8.5.1 and later, after new snapshots appear on a volume, Safeguarded backups are not created.
  • [For Veeam Backup & Replication versions prior to 12.1 (build 12.1.0.2131)] When you add IBM Spectrum Virtualize storage systems with HyperSwap function to the backup infrastructure, Veeam Backup & Replication, by default, works with primary storage volumes.
